S14 flooding
Hey guys, I bought a s14 w/ a blown motor, so I replaced the motor (kade to kade) and did a 5sp swap at the same time.
The motor is stock. Stock AUTO ecu. VSS in unplugged (wasnt able to find a s14 VSS yet). I did all the wiring step by step exactly the same as the walkthroughs available for the 5sp swap, but now the car starts for a few seconds, idles very low (200 rpm maybe), and dies within seconds... I can start the car for a few times, but then it dies out and smells like fuel, so Im pretty sure its flooding the engine. I've unplugged the MAF to see if it would make any difference, but it doesnt. Checked vaccum lines, but they all seem ok. What else should I check?
